Excelで資料を作成する際に、ここからここへ、という明示をするために矢印のオートシェイプを使うことがあります。, こんな感じで表形式の左から右へ、みたいな感じとかですね。実はこの矢印は後述のマクロでやってます。3本引くのに10秒も掛かっていません。, 通常はこのように左から右に、という具合に手で矢印を引くのですが、いろいろと難点があります。 エクセルでカレンダーを作成する方法を解説。関数を使ったカレンダーの作り方で、祝日にも自動で色を付けます。オリジナルデザインのカレンダーを作ってみましょう。, EXCEL上の図形にセルの値を表示する方法 と、思ったようにいきません。, そこで、選択セル範囲の開始セルから終了セルにこんな感じで矢印のオートシェイプを引くマクロを紹介します。, 色は赤で太さを1.5ポイントにしていますが、RGB関数と数字を1.5と書いてるソースなので、修正したい場合はそこだけ変えればOKです。. //-->. 他の関連記事と合わせて仕事や趣味に役立ててください。, エクセルでカレンダーを作ってみよう|祝日も自動で色付けできる (adsbygoogle=window.adsbygoogle||[]).push({}); 細かい処理はコメントに書いている通りです。考え方で難しいのは3番の矢印を引く開始横位置と終了横位置です。左から右に引く場合と右から左に引く場合で開始と終了の横位置が変わります。, なお、Office2003と2007あたりでAddConnector関数の挙動が異なっています。2003以前の場合は71行目を削除して73行目の方を使ってください。, 1. The following example adds two rectangles to, Excel オブジェクト モデル リファレンス, Office VBA またはこの説明書に関するご質問やフィードバックがありますか?. 矢印や直線のバリエーションを増やしてよりよい資料作成にチャレンジしましょう。, メニューの「挿入」から「図」「図形」とすすみます。 矢印を引きたい範囲を選択します。このとき、矢印を引きたい方向と同じ向きにセル範囲を選択します。この例ではA1セルを開始セルとしてC4セルまでを選択しています。, 他にも以下のように開始セル(Start)から終了セル(End)に向かってセル範囲を選択した場合のパターンでも利用できます。, '   ActiveSheet.Shapes.AddConnector(msoConnectorStraight, dStartX, dStartY, dEndX - dStartX, dEndY - dStartY).Select. マクロVBAで、オートシェイプ(図形)を扱う場合の解説です。オートシェイプ(図形)はShapeオブジェクトであり、ShapeオブジェクトのコレクションがShapesコレクションになります。Shapeオブジェクトは、多くのオブジェクトをメンバーに持った複雑なオブジェクトとなっています。 google_ad_height = 90; Excelで地図を描く方法を解説します。私鉄やJRの線路や道路、河川の描き方やアーチ状のテキスト配置など、最寄駅から自宅や店舗までの地図を描いてみませんか?, エクセルで絵を描く|図形を使った『ドラえもん』の描きかた サポートの受け方およびフィードバックをお寄せいただく方法のガイダンスについては、, Office VBA のサポートおよびフィードバック, 以前のバージョンのドキュメント. エクセルでガンチャートを作成しましたが、矢印を自動で引くマクロで、日付日時の参照で、例えば、2018/9/25 0:00:00と設定しているセルは認識しなく矢印が引けなくなりますこの原因がお解りなる方、いませんか?Findによる日付の検索は シートに挿入できる図形の一覧が表示されるので、その中から「線矢印」を選んでクリックします。, ▲「最近使用した図形」の中に矢印が表示されていれば、そちらをクリックしても同じです, 線の引き方は簡単です。 図形(オートシェイプ)を使って『ドラえもん』を描く方法を解説。最近話題のエクセルを使って描く絵をピックアップ。エクセルを使って簡単に絵を描いて楽しもう!. エクセルグラフ Have questions or feedback about Office VBA or this documentation? オートシェイプ図形の種類を表す定数(MsoAutoShapeType 列挙型) MsoAutoShapeType 列挙型の一覧表 コネクタは、結合点と呼ばれる点で 2 つの図形を接続する線です。A connector is a line that attaches two other shapes at points called connection sites. エクセルでガンチャートを作成しましたが、矢印を自動で引くマクロで、日付日時の参照で、例えば、2018/9/25 0:00:00と設定しているセルは認識しなく矢印が引けなくなりますこの原因がお解りなる方、いませんか?Findによる日付の検索は google_ad_width = 728; google_ad_client = "pub-8092962482169671"; © 1995 - Office TANAKA (function(b,c,f,g,a,d,e){b.MoshimoAffiliateObject=a;b[a]=b[a]||function(){arguments.currentScript=c.currentScript||c.scripts[c.scripts.length-2];(b[a].q=b[a].q||[]).push(arguments)};c.getElementById(a)||(d=c.createElement(f),d.src=g,d.id=a,e=c.getElementsByTagName("body")[0],e.appendChild(d))})(window,document,"script","//dn.msmstatic.com/site/cardlink/bundle.js","msmaflink");msmaflink({"n":"会計ソフトのすき間を埋める 経理のExcel仕事術","b":"","t":"","d":"https:\/\/m.media-amazon.com","c_p":"","p":["\/images\/I\/51DPc5xisrL.jpg"],"u":{"u":"https:\/\/www.amazon.co.jp\/dp\/B08GP4VFZ9","t":"amazon","r_v":""},"aid":{"amazon":"1788294","rakuten":"1788275","yahoo":"1788295"},"eid":"LVMIu","s":"s"}); (function(b,c,f,g,a,d,e){b.MoshimoAffiliateObject=a;b[a]=b[a]||function(){arguments.currentScript=c.currentScript||c.scripts[c.scripts.length-2];(b[a].q=b[a].q||[]).push(arguments)};c.getElementById(a)||(d=c.createElement(f),d.src=g,d.id=a,e=c.getElementsByTagName("body")[0],e.appendChild(d))})(window,document,"script","//dn.msmstatic.com/site/cardlink/bundle.js","msmaflink");msmaflink({"n":"Excel 最強の教科書[完全版]――すぐに使えて、一生役立つ「成果を生み出す」超エクセル仕事術","b":"","t":"","d":"https:\/\/m.media-amazon.com","c_p":"","p":["\/images\/I\/51U6KUG6tyL.jpg"],"u":{"u":"https:\/\/www.amazon.co.jp\/dp\/B01MYC8LPQ","t":"amazon","r_v":""},"aid":{"amazon":"1788294","rakuten":"1788275","yahoo":"1788295"},"eid":"XpWbn","s":"s"}); 関連記事 Excelで図形の矢印を作成・編集する方法|Microsoft office, このサイトはスパムを低減するために Akismet を使っています。コメントデータの処理方法の詳細はこちらをご覧ください。, 40代パパ(妻&子供3人)モノづくり中小企業の会社員。10年以上仕事と趣味で得たPCスキルで初心者に解りやすくをモットーに情報シェア!, 2019年6月ブログ開始 ★PV(ページ閲覧数) 最高:65,000pv (月間PV5桁継続中) ¥ブログ月間収益 2020年10月⇒5桁達成, 【好きなモノ一覧】 ・パソコン・ガジェット・ゲーム・マンガ・アニメ・ヒーローモノ映画・ジャンク・中古品・古着・無料コンテンツ, 大量の数値を入力したら全部プラスマイナスが逆だった場合、入力し直すのはとても大変な作業になります。ここでは初心者でもできる、セルの数値をまとめてプラスマイナスを逆にする方法をご紹介します。, Microsoft Excelでセルの幅や高さを変更する方法をご紹介します。他のバージョンのExcelでも同じ操作になりますので参考にしてください。入力した文字がセルからはみ出してしまった場合などの対処に行う操作です。, Microsoft Excelで印刷する前に良く行う操作の印刷プレビューを最速で表示させる方法をご紹介します。印刷プレビューはショートカットキー操作を使えば一発で表示できます。他のアプリでも使える操作ですので汎用性が高いです。, 【簡単】家族5人分のマイナンバーカードをオンラインで申請してみた|マイナポイントに向けての準備. 図形・ドラえもん 直線やテキストボックス、図形の作成方法VBAで直線やテキストボックス、図形を作成するには、図形の集まりを表すShapes【シェイプス】コレクションのメソッドを使用します。Shapes【シェイプス】コレクションのメソッド一覧メソッド内容A 図形オートシェイプを複数選択するVBAについてのサンプルと簡単な解説です。Shapeオブジェクトは非常に複雑で、簡単な操作でもVBAの書き方が分からない場合も多くあります。Shapeの基本については以下を参照してください。 「見やすいシリーズ」第二弾!エクセルで見やすいグラフ・きれいなグラフの作り方。グラフがあることで、数値の差や変化などが視覚的に伝わることで資料を見る人が理解しやすくなります。, EXCELで地図を描く|私鉄・JR・河川・道路もきれいに描ける グリッドとずれる。 VBAで直線やテキストボックス、図形を作成するには、図形の集まりを表すShapes【シェイプス】コレクションのメソッドを使用します。, ワークシート上に直線を引くには、Shapes【シェイプス】コレクションのAddLine【アドライン】メソッドを使用します。, オブジェクト.AddLine( BeginX, BeginY, EndX, EndY ), ※位置の指定の単位はポイント(1ポイントは約0.35ミリ)でセルの行の高さの単位です。 セルに合わせて直線を引くには、Range【レンジ】オブジェクトのTop・Left・Heihht・Wodthプロパティで座標(ポイント)を取得して指定します。, ワークシート上にテキストボックスを作成するには、Shapes【シェイプス】コレクションのAddTextbox【アドテキストフボックス】メソッドを使用します。, オブジェクト.AddTxetbox( Orientation, Left, Top, Width, Height ), ワークシート上に図形を作成するには、Shapes【シェイプス】コレクションのAddShape【アドシェイプ】メソッドを使用します。, オブジェクト.AddShape( Type, Left, Top, Width, Height ) 【戻り値】Shapeオブジェクトを返します。, 3行目【For i = 1 To 183】 For【フォー】ステートメントでの繰り返し処理の始まりです。カウンター変数「i」に1~183(図形数)の値を順次 代入していきます。, 4行目【On Error Resume Next】 図形タイプの値138番はサポートされていない図形で図形を取得出来ずにエラーが発生するため On Error Resume Nextステートメントで変数iが138になったときに発生するエラーを無視して処理を続行します。, 5~6行目【With ActiveSheet.Shapes.AddShape(Type:=i, Left:=Range(“B” & i).Left + 2.5, Top:=Range(“B” & i).Top + 2.5, Width:=Range(“B” & i).Width – 5, Height:=Range(“B” & i).Height – 5)】 Worksheet【ワークシート】オブジェクトのShapes【シェイプス】プロパティで図形の集まりを表すShapes【シェイプス】コレクションを参照し、AddShape【アドシェイプ】メソッドで図形を追加します。引数Type【タイプ】は変数iで図形の定数の値1~183を繰り返し処理の中で順次代入していきます。引数Left【レフト】、引数Top【トップ】、引数Width【ワイズ】、引数Height【カイト】はRange【レンジ】オブジェクトのLeft、Top、Width、Heightプロパティを使用して図形がセル内に収まるように位置のポイントを取得しています。この作成した図形をWith【ウィズ】ステートメントで指定します。, 7行目【.Line.ForeColor.RGB = RGB(0, 0, 0)】 Withステートメントで指定したShape【シェイプ】オブジェクトに対してLine【ライン】プロパティで線を引きForeColor【フォアカラー】ステートメントでRGB関数を使用して 黒に線を塗りつぶしています。, 8行目【.Fill.Visible = False】 Fillプロパティ(図形の塗りつぶし)をViSible = falseにすることにより図形の塗りつぶしを透明色にしています。, ※位置の指定の単位はポイント(1ポイントは約0.35ミリ)でセルの行の高さの単位です。, ( Orientation, Left, Top, Width, Height ), 作成する図形の種類をMsoAutoShapeType列挙型の定数、または値で指定します。, 5~6行目【With ActiveSheet.Shapes.AddShape(Type:=i, Left:=Range(“B” & i).Left + 2.5, Top:=Range(“B” & i).Top + 2.5, Width:=Range(“B” & i).Width – 5, Height:=Range(“B” & i).Height – 5)】, msoTextOrientationHorizontalRotatedFarEas.

.

みなとみらい バースデープレート 可愛い, 立体切断 アプリ 無料, 七つの大罪 タルミエル 声優, ジミン ピアス 位置 2020, 七つの大罪 タルミエル 声優, 教育実習 プレゼント メッセージカード, 教育実習 プレゼント 幼稚園, 年間カレンダー 2020 4月始まり, ジミン ピアス 位置 2020, プロポーズ デザート メッセージ, オークス オッズ 投票, 鬼 滅 の刃 ご当地 キーホルダー 岩手, コンビニ キャッシュレス還元 されない, コンビニ キャッシュレス還元 されない, 阪神 住吉 時刻表, 和田明日香 上野樹里 仲, ノートパソコン 天 板 保護, 金運 待ち受け 即効, 和田明日香 上野樹里 仲, 鈴木愛理 グッズ Tシャツ, スイカ オートチャージ コンビニ, 金運 待ち受け 即効,